How the formula works

Both us hundredweight per fluid ounce and microgram per cubic yard measure the same physical quantity (mass per unit volume), so converting between them is a single multiplication. Multiply a value in us hundredweight per fluid ounce by 1.172658e15 to get microgram per cubic yard. To reverse the conversion, multiply a microgram per cubic yard value by 8.527638e-16 to get back to us hundredweight per fluid ounce.
